The first trailer for “Avengers: Doomsday” draws major attention worldwide, reaching about 503 million views within 24 hours, according to reporting from Variety and Times of India. Both outlets describe the launch as one of the largest trailer debuts ever and note that it ranks behind Sony’s upcoming “Spider-Man: Brand New Day,” which is reported to have 719 million views. Times of India adds that the trailer is Disney’s biggest trailer launch and the second-highest overall. Both sources characterize the trailer as previewing a multiversal threat that brings together Marvel heroes, including a mix of new and returning characters. Times of India also reports that advance ticket sales for some premium screenings begin strongly, reinforcing the film’s positioning as a major theatrical release. The Russo brothers are also quoted in Times of India as thanking fans as the views milestone is reached. Overall, the coverage focuses on the scale of the trailer’s initial audience and how it compares with other recent blockbuster marketing launches.
